TikTok has emerged as the undisputed champion, now the most-used social media platform in the country. Its usage surged to 35.17% in 2025, a remarkable jump from 18.61% just a year prior, signaling a mass migration, particularly from Facebook, which saw its share plummet to 21.58%. This platform has become the "digital home" for Indonesia's youth, with a staggering 42.27% of Gen Z flocking to its short, interactive videos. TikTok's dominance is a testament to its powerful algorithm, its seamless integration of in-app shopping via TikTok Shop, and its appeal as a non-Western alternative in a shifting geopolitical landscape. Indonesia is experiencing a massive digital renaissance. With over 200 million internet users, the archipelago has become one of the world's largest consumers of online media. From viral TikTok dances in Jakarta to cinematic vlogs in Bali, Indonesian entertainment and popular videos are reshaping global digital culture.

Indonesia has a deep-seated fascination with the supernatural. Horror content is immensely popular. Creators film late-night explorations of abandoned buildings, discuss local urban legends (like the Pocong or Kuntilanak ), and share podcast-style ghost stories. YouTube, while often associated with older generations, remains an absolute juggernaut for long-form and short-form content. Indonesia leads Southeast Asia in YouTube subscribers, boasting 3,000 accounts with over one million subscribers, which accounts for 40% of the total in the ASEAN region. The top YouTuber is Jess No Limit, with a staggering 54.2 million subscribers, followed by Ricis Official and Frost Diamond.
